If you genuinely want a LOT of the crap on television to just go away, tell your congresscritters that you support "A la carte" cable instead of being required by the cable companies to sell you tons of crap in a bundle just to get one or two channels that you really care about. If that happens, you can vote with your dollars. Now, if you want the history channel, you still have to pay for Oprah and the Lawn and Garden channel. I have a friend that really only watches NASCAR but to get the NASCAR channels, he has to buy the ultra-super-duper-premium-platinum-edition cable bundle and pays some insane monthly fee (over $150 per month, I think) just to watch two or three channels that he likes. All that money pays to support crap that he doesn't want, doesn't like, and never watches. The cable company really doesn't care if he doesn't like Nancy Grace or Oprah Winfrey or anything else since his checks come in the mail every month.

Only paying for the channels that you want might also influence channels like the History Channel to actually put some history stuff back on since people who specifically choose to watch history might not be thrilled to pay for "Finding Bigfoot" all day.

The idea is really great. There are a couple of problems though:

The time for this to happen was 15 years ago. Now, with all the evolving technologies and entertainment delivery options, the traditional cable model is on the way out the door sooner rather than later. Nobody is going to go to all the trouble of rearranging everything and invalidating hundreds of contracts to get it done while we are in the middle of changing the whole paradigm. Plus, even if it did, I would not be shocked if the resulting system did not end up costing the consumer about the same or more. I'm confident they would find a way to make that happen. Perhaps a baseline charge for "cable" service, and then you get to pay for your channels.

Secondly, the federal government has zero business making any kind of law on how a company has to package or not package their services. It's not health or safety related in the least, and it's just not what the government is for. At all.
